Output dd9aa40683ceee018f287718a7be96a73296f0ceede4073af86ff2163356a305:0

value
5399564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 098ddac2aef65a7294e1f8e157d6e5bea5ec37a2 OP_EQUAL
address
M8mgFP8hSihQNL6Xh6SQ1ZxBFFdpXrnnXJ
transaction
dd9aa40683ceee018f287718a7be96a73296f0ceede4073af86ff2163356a305
spent
true